About

Burton Zitomer is a business attorney with over 43 years of legal experience, practicing at Schwartz Simon Edelstein Celso & Kessler LLC in Morristown, NJ. He attended Suffolk University Law School and earned a B.A. from Rutgers University in 1965, a M.A. from Rutgers University in 1966, and a J.D. from Suffolk University Law School in 1969. He has been admitted to the New York Bar since 1982. His practice encompasses business and construction and development, allowing him to serve clients across a range of legal needs.
